Columbus Overview
As of 2007, Columbus's population is 733,203 people. Since 2000, it has had a population growth of 3.05 percent.
The median home cost in Columbus is $182,200. Home appreciation the last year has been 0.45 percent.
Compared to the rest of the country, Columbus's cost of living is 13.60% Lower than the U.S. average.
Columbus public schools spend $6,445 per student. The average school expenditure in the U.S. is $6,058. There are about 19 students per teacher in Columbus.
The unemployment rate in Columbus is 4.60 percent (U.S. avg. is 4.60%). Recent job growth is Positive. Columbus jobs have Increased by 1.92 percent.
Columbus Economy
The unemployment rate in Columbus, OH, is 4.60%, with job growth of 1.92%. Future job growth over the next ten years is predicted to be 24.59%.
Columbus, OH Taxes
Columbus, OH, sales tax rate is 6.75%. Income tax is 6.99%.
Columbus, OH Income and Salaries
The income per capita is $24,152, which includes all adults and children. The median household income is $43,731.
Columbus Housing
The median home value in Columbus, OH, is $182,200. Home appreciation is 0.45% over the last year. The median age of Columbus, OH, real estate is 32 years.
Columbus, OH Apartments and Rentals
Renters make up 46.68% of the Columbus, OH, population. 7.73% of houses and apartments in Columbus, OH, are unoccupied (vacancy rate).
Columbus Education
Columbus, OH, schools spend $6,445 per student. There are 19 pupils per teacher, 701 students per librarian, and 545 children per counselor in Columbus, OH schools.
